Get Your Packages Delivered to Van Alstyne Police Department

Are you having packages delivered to your home this holiday season? Do you have a Van Alstyne address?

If so starting Friday, November 24, 2023, you may have your packages delivered to the Van Alstyne Police Department at 242 N. Preston Ave & dispatch will sign for them 24/7. Dispatch will sign for your deliveries from November 24th until January 1st, and you may pick them up any time of day or night. You must have a current Driver’s License or state issued ID card with you when you pick up your packages. Please make sure the package is addressed to the person who will be picking it up.

We hope this will prevent package thefts in our community. If you have questions, please call us at 903-482-5251.

 

New Public Safety Facility for Van Alstyne

In an era of growth and development, Van Alstyne is taking a significant step to bolster public safety by planning a new, state-of-the-art facility for its police and fire departments. This $20 million project is not just an investment in infrastructure but a commitment to the safety and well-being of our community. Located at the corner of Waco St. and Blassingame Ave., the new site remains central to Van Alstyne and provides easy access to Hwy 5 and Hwy 75.

The process to realize this facility has been meticulous and collaborative. Input from 14 distinguished architects and studies conducted by two external companies have played a crucial role in shaping the size and design of the facility. A project manager will also be brought on board for this project. This comprehensive approach ensures that the facility will meet the highest standards of functionality and efficiency.

The chosen designer, Brandstetter Carroll, Inc., is working closely with Police Chief Barnes, Fire Chief Dockery, and the City Manager. Their joint efforts focus on creating a design that not only addresses current requirements but also anticipates the needs of our community for years to come.

This new facility is more than a building; it’s a symbol of our city’s dedication to ensuring a safe, secure, and thriving community for all residents of Van Alstyne. Stay tuned as we continue on this exciting journey towards a safer future.

Eula Umphress and Robert Hynds Park

UPDATE (01/10/2024):
Exciting progress on the new park. Pond is excavated and local clay soil has been installed for pond lining purposes. Contractor has completed major materials submittals and long lead time items are on order for delivery. Water and sewer improvements are being completed. Contractor is working on schedule.

Van Alstyne Parks & Recreation is adding an incredible new park to our community!  Located just north of the Georgetown Village subdivision, between Kelly Ln. & S. Dallas Ave., this park will be 24 acres and includes a fishing pond, pavilion, playground, restrooms, and plenty of green space, and of course walking trails. In the city’s masterplan, the walking trails will connect all of Van Alstyne’s parks.

A nice feature of this new development in our community is it is fully paid for and will not impact taxes at all!

Van Alstyne City Council awarded the construction contract in September the groundbreaking took place on September 25th. The expected completion date is Spring of 2024!

Old Fashioned Christmas, December 2nd

Mark your calendars for December 2nd in Van Alstyne! With it being our 150th Anniversary, the theme for this year’s holiday events is “Old Fashioned Christmas” and we are kicking off the holiday season in a BIG way! The Van Alstyne Christmas Parade through downtown will kick off the festivities at 2pm as well as a Christmas Market on Marshall.

Register to participate in the parade here. There will be three categories for awards this year.
1.) Best of the Best
2.) Best use of the theme (“Old Fashioned Christmas”)
3.) Best Holiday Spirit

You can also find a Christmas Market and DJ on Marshall Street, face painting, bounce house and slide, photos with all of your favorite Christmas characters and then join us for the Tree Lighting Ceremony at 6pm at the Central Social District Park.

 

There will also be live performances in the Central Social District Park starting at 5:30 by the VAHS Choir, VAHS Band, Certain Music, Rogers Martial Arts and Fierce Motions in Dance. And if you think we’ve forgot about the big guy, you’re mistaken! Santa & Mrs. Claus will be in attendance for free photos as well from 2-5:30.

In addition to our wonderful December 2nd activities, we hope our entire community will participate and help decorate our incredible town for this year’s holiday season.  Van Alstyne Parks and Recreation department is hosting a Decorating Contest and we invite all Van Alstyne homes & businesses to participate by submitting a photo of their home/business decorated for the ‘Old Fashioned Christmas’ theme. Submit a photo by emailing it with your address to khessel@cityofvanalstyne.us by December 14th.  Voting will take place on the Van Alstyne Parks & Recreation Facebook page and the photo with the most ‘likes’ wins! Winner will get a $50 Visa gift card.

Van Alstyne Historical Museum Has A New Location

Wednesday, November 1st, 2023 was the incredibly well attended ribbon cutting for the new location of the Van Alstyne Historical Museum at 130 N Waco St. in Van Alstyne.

This home was built around 1890 on the east side of town and was moved to its current location a few years later. It is a wonderfully appropriate setting to host the Van Alstyne Historical Museum and is a “museum within a museum” as Mayor Jim Atchison explained.

The museum is open Tuesday, Thursday, and Saturday from 1pm – 3pm. Private, group tours can be arranged with museum Director, Teddie Ann Salmon, 903-814-1735. Parking is plentiful at the new location and it is conveniently located between the Van Alstyne Public Library and the Van Alstyne US Post Office.
